Replace direct error equality checks (err == pgx.ErrNoRows, err != http.ErrServerClosed) with the idiomatic errors.Is() function throughout handlers, services, middleware, and app startup. This correctly handles wrapped error chains. Also replace a raw type assertion (*HTTPError) with errors.AsType[*HTTPError]() in the error handler middleware for consistency. Additionally, rename shadowed variables for clarity: - sidecar.go: config -> sidecarConfig, systemConfig (shadowed package-level vars) - media_scanner.go: uuid -> uuidString (shadowed the uuid package import)
